What Monsoon Wind-Driven Rain Does to Phoenix Roofs

Shingle roof with wind and storm damage in Phoenix

The short answer: monsoon storms drive rain sideways, forcing water up under tiles, past flashing, and into openings that gentle winter rain never tests. That is why a roof can stay dry all winter and leak in July. Here is how wind-driven rain actually moves, and what it finds.

Every year around this time, our phone starts ringing with the same story. The roof was fine all winter. It rained a few times in January and February and not a drop got inside. Then the first real monsoon storm of the summer rolls through, and by the next morning there is a brown ring on the living room ceiling. Homeowners are confused, and honestly, a little frustrated. If the roof handled winter rain, why did July break it?

The answer is that monsoon rain and winter rain are two completely different things, and Phoenix roofs are tested in ways a gentle winter shower never reveals. Wind-driven rain is the culprit, and once you understand how it moves, the leak makes a lot more sense.

Winter Rain Falls. Monsoon Rain Attacks.

A typical Phoenix winter storm is slow and steady. The rain comes almost straight down, the wind is mild, and the water lands on your roof and runs off exactly the way the roof was designed to shed it. Tiles overlap like shingles on a fish, water flows down the surface, into the valleys, off the eaves, and into the gutters. Everything works because gravity is doing the job the roof was built around.

Monsoon storms do not play by those rules. A strong Phoenix thunderstorm can dump a large volume of rain in twenty or thirty minutes, and it arrives sideways. Microburst and outflow winds ahead of a storm can gust past 60 miles per hour, and they push rain at a low, flat angle instead of straight down. That changes everything about how water behaves on your roof.

When rain is driven horizontally, it does not just run down the surface. It gets forced under the leading edge of tiles, up and beneath the overlaps, sideways into flashing joints, and into any gap that a vertical rain would have flowed right past. Water starts moving uphill. Gravity is no longer the only force in play, and the parts of your roof that never see moisture in a normal rain suddenly get soaked.

That is why a roof can pass every winter with a clean record and still fail on the first serious monsoon night.

What Wind-Driven Rain Actually Does to a Tile Roof

Most Phoenix homes wear concrete or clay tile, and tile roofs have a specific weakness that monsoon rain finds every time.

Here is the part that surprises people: the tiles are not what keeps water out of your house. The tiles are a sunshade and a wind shield. The real waterproof barrier is the underlayment underneath them, the membrane layer fastened to the roof deck. In a normal rain, very little water ever reaches that layer. In a wind-driven monsoon downpour, water gets forced under the tiles in volume and the underlayment has to do all the work.

On a healthy roof, it does. On an older roof, it does not. And this is where Phoenix has a problem that most of the country does not. Our extreme heat bakes underlayment brittle years before the tiles wear out. Standard 30-pound felt, which sits under a huge number of homes built in the 1990s and early 2000s across places like Sun City, Surprise, and the older Valley tracts, typically lasts only 15 to 20 years in our climate before it dries out and cracks. The clay or concrete tiles above it can last 50 years or more, so the roof looks perfect from the street while the layer that actually matters has quietly failed.

Put those two facts together and monsoon season becomes the moment of truth. Wind-driven rain pushes water past the tiles, the aged underlayment cannot hold it back, and it finds the deck, the insulation, and eventually your ceiling. Shingle and Foam Roofs Get Tested Too

Tile is not the only roof type that struggles with wind-driven rain.

On asphalt shingle roofs, the danger points are the edges and the seams. Horizontal wind can lift the tabs of aging or poorly sealed shingles just enough for water to blow underneath, and once it is under the shingle it runs toward the nail line. Flashing around chimneys, skylights, and wall transitions takes a beating too, because that is exactly where sideways rain concentrates. Shingles that have spent a decade cooking in Phoenix sun lose the flexibility and the sealant grip that would normally keep them locked down, which is why sun damage and wind damage so often show up together. Flat foam roofs on modern and mid-century Valley homes face a different version of the same test. Foam sheds water by slope and coating, and a wind-driven storm can drive rain into any spot where the coating has thinned, cracked, or pulled away at a parapet or penetration. Add the ponding that happens when debris clogs a scupper or drain during a storm, and water sits on weak spots far longer than the system was built to handle.

Your Roof Is Already Weakened Before the Storm Arrives

Here is the piece a generic weather article will never tell you: Phoenix roofs walk into monsoon season pre-damaged by heat.

On a July afternoon, the surface of a tile roof can reach 150 to 180 degrees. Shingle surfaces and foam coatings get punishing exposure too. That heat is not a one-time event. Your roof cycles from a warm dawn to a scorching mid-afternoon and back down every single day, expanding and contracting hundreds of times a year. Sealants harden, flashing joints loosen, underlayment grows brittle, and shingle adhesive gives up its grip.

So when the first outflow winds and sideways rain hit in June or July, they are not testing a fresh roof. They are testing a roof that has been slowly stressed and dried out by months of extreme sun. The heat opens the gaps, and the monsoon finds them. That combination is specific to the desert Southwest, and it is why roofs here fail in patterns that would puzzle a contractor from a milder climate.

Where the Water Gets In

When we track down a monsoon leak, the entry point is almost always one of a handful of usual suspects:

  • Valleys, where two roof planes meet and wind-driven water concentrates and moves fast
  • Flashing at walls, chimneys, and skylights, where sideways rain is aimed straight at the seam
  • Roof penetrations for vents, pipes, and conduit, where old rubber boots have cracked in the sun
  • The eaves and fascia line, where wind can drive rain up and under the starter course
  • Ridges and hips, where displaced or cracked tiles expose the underlayment to direct spray

Notice that most of these are not the broad, open field of the roof. They are the transitions and edges, the exact places horizontal rain targets and vertical rain ignores. A roof can have a perfectly sound main surface and still leak badly because one flashing joint or one cracked vent boot let the storm in.

What to Do After a Monsoon Storm

If you get through a storm and everything looks dry, that is good news, but it is not a guarantee. Water can travel a long way along a rafter or a deck seam before it shows up as a stain, sometimes days later. A little attention after each significant storm goes a long way.

From the ground, look for tiles that have slipped out of line, shingle tabs that are lifted or missing, debris piled in valleys, and any granules or broken tile pieces washed into the gutters or onto the patio. Inside, check upper-story ceilings and closets for fresh discoloration, and take a look in the attic with a flashlight for damp insulation or dark streaks on the underside of the deck. If you find anything, photograph it before you touch it, since clear documentation helps if the damage turns into an insurance conversation later.

Frequently Asked Questions

Why does my roof only leak during monsoon storms and never in winter?

Because winter rain falls gently and straight down, so your roof sheds it exactly as designed. Monsoon rain arrives in high volume and is driven sideways by strong winds, which forces water under tiles, into flashing seams, and past edges that vertical rain never reaches. A roof with an aging underlayment or a worn flashing joint can shed winter rain all season and still fail the first time it faces a wind-driven downpour.

My tiles look perfect but my ceiling is stained. How is that possible?

The tiles are not your waterproof layer. The underlayment beneath them is, and in Phoenix that underlayment often wears out decades before the tiles do because of our heat. When wind-driven rain pushes water under the tiles and the underlayment has gone brittle, the water reaches the deck and your ceiling while the tiles above still look flawless.

Should I get on my roof to check for damage after a storm?

We do not recommend it. Wet tile and shingle are slick, and walking on tile can crack it and create the next leak. Do your inspection from the ground and from inside the attic, and leave the on-roof assessment to someone with the right footwear, harness, and experience.

How soon after a monsoon storm should I get a leak looked at?

Sooner is always cheaper. Water that gets in during a storm keeps doing damage to the deck, framing, and insulation long after the sky clears, and mold can start within a couple of days. If you see any interior staining or find damage from the ground, it is worth having it checked promptly rather than waiting for the next storm to make it worse.

Does monsoon damage get covered by homeowners insurance?

It depends on your policy and the cause, and we cannot speak for your carrier. What helps in any claim is documentation: dated photos of the damage, a record of when the storm hit, and a professional assessment of what failed.
